  • T3DSO Passive Probe, 350 MHz, 10X, 10 MOhm, 300V/600V

    T3PP350A - Teledyne LeCroy

    Passive probes are the standard probe provided with most oscilloscopes. Typical passive probes provide a 10:1 attenuation and feature a high input resistance of 10 MΩ. This high input resistance means that passive probes are the ideal tool for low frequency signals since circuit loading at these frequencies is minimized. Passive probes are designed to handle voltages of at least 400V, some as high as 600V. Teledyne LeCroy passive probes feature an attenuation sense pin which tells the oscilloscope to scale the waveforms automatically requiring no user input.

  • Grid Simulators

    LXinstruments GmbH

    A grid simulator can be used to simulate the characteristics of low-voltage mains. For this purpose, all voltages and frequencies of the supply networks occurring worldwide can be simulated. Critical states such as short-term voltage dips or voltage peaks (surge/burst) can also be generated.The integrated sequencer function enables the generation of different network parameters, e.g. distorted waveforms and intermediate oscillations. Therefore, grid simulators are well suited for testing conformity to standards and especially for determining the behaviour of electrical equipment in borderline situations. Many European and other international standards are pre-programmed for testing.
